This handbook is a guide to cervical cytology for clinicians.



Beginning with an overview of anatomy and normal cytology, the next chapter discusses sample collection and screening.



The following sections discuss reporting systems, malignancy, atypical cells, carcinoma, tumours and management of cervical lesions. Interpretation of screening, differential diagnosis and treatment methods are discussed in depth.



The text concludes with a chapter presenting sample cases with answers.



Throughout the book, emphasis is placed on liquid-based cytology preparation, with discussion on varying viewpoints regarding interpretation.



Microphotographs illustrating normal and abnormal cervical smears are included to enhance understanding.
